The Sibyl (2023)

The Sibyl (2023) poster

In the mid-20th century, a troubled relationship between Germana, a young writer, and Quina, her aunt who lives in the northern Portuguese countryside. Feelings of jealousy, admiration and the complex magnetism between these two strong women arise.

Director: Eduardo Brito
Genre: Drama
Runtime: 80 min
